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os lawyers are dedicated to helping families and victims receive the financial support they deserve. These lawyers work for national firms with access to asbestos databases and a track record of obtaining significant cases and settlements.

They assist mesothelioma patients to make a personal injury claim or wrongful death suit against the companies that exposed them. Most of these cases are settled before trial.

Getting the financial help you need

Financial assistance can help you reduce anxiety during treatment and help you pay for medical expenses. It can also assist you in making ends meet. Compensation for mesothelioma may assist in paying for future and past medical treatment as well as legal costs, lost income, loss of earning capacity, pain and discomfort, and other damages. The amount you get is according to your state and type of mesothelioma. There are three types of mesothelioma lawsuits: personal injury, wrongful deaths and trust funds. A personal injury lawsuit seeks compensation from the defendant that caused the illness. This is the most common form of mesothelioma case. Patients' families can claim wrongful deaths to seek comp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the death of the victim.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ed at one of the many asbestos compensation trust funds set up by asbestos companies or the government.

A lawsuit could take years to resolve. It can also be difficult to get an equitable settlement. Some asbestos companies try to delay the process by filing frivolous motions. Your mesothelioma lawyer has experience in identifying these tactics and thwarting them.

Depending on where you reside and the type of mesothelioma you have, and the time you were exposed to asbestos, there are a variety of statutes of limitations that are applicable to your case. Some states have short time limits, whereas others have longer timeframes to make a claim.

A mesothelioma trial can last several years. However, if the patient is very sick or has a short life expectancy, judges could accelerate the trial. The presiding judge will determine whether there is a need to accelerate the trial, and the court will order the defendant to answer any claims made by the plaintiff.
